Wardrobe Tips
When you are preparing for your session and wondering what to wear keep these tips in mind:
-Simplicity is KEY! Solid colors are best. Avoid large or bold patterns and bright colors (they draw attention away from the face).
-Long sleeve dresses and shirts are recommended.
-Darker clothing tends to minimize body size and light tones tend to emphasize body size.
-Do not mix light and dark colors. Save stronger colors and patterns for accent items like scarves and neckties.
-White or light pastel clothing looks best in portraits taken against white or light backgrounds. Dark clothing looks best photographed against darker backgrounds and creates a more formal mood.
-Earth tones are best for outdoor portraits.
-Traditional style clothing will keep your portraits looking fresh for years.

Pre-Session Tips
Good Morning!
So in my next few blogs I want to focus on tips to prepare you for your upcoming sessions, whether they are scheduled with me or not. This first one is geared more towards "Senior Sessions." Figured that would be a good starting point since, at least around here, we're getting close to "Senior Season" for 2011 Seniors. And don't hesitate to leave a question in the comment section or contact me some other way if you need more information. :-) So sit back, grab your coffee, and let the info sink in! ;-)
#1 - Remember anything you might need during your session (brush, hairspray, lip gloss, etc)
#2 - Be careful of sun exposure prior to the session. I cannot edit out tan lines and sun burns do not photograph well
#3 - Bring several changes of clothes, preferably different STYLES like casual, dressy, personal (cheer uniform, team jersey, etc)
#4 - Bring props that show your personality
IDEAS:
* Musical Instruments
* School Jacket
* Class Ring
* Hats
* Uniforms (athletic, band, FFA, etc)
* Sports Equipment
* Sunglasses
#5 - Wear your hair as you do normally. Guys should NOT have a fresh haircut. If you need a trim, schedule for at least a week before your portraits.
